I made a live USB of Mint 19.1 using Etcher on a 500gb External Hard Drive with a format of MS-DOS FAT using Disk Utility to format on my mac running Mac OSX Yosemite. This live USB loads perfectly by using the Option Key on my iMac. Now I want to permanently install Mint 19.1 to this same 500gb external hard drive because I want to save the changes I make after each session. I successfully complete all the steps including selecting my 500gb drive as the destination drive, then when I click on 'Install' get a message saying ' No root file system is defined. Please correct this from the partitioning menu', then I just quit the installation. How can I complete the installation. I assume that after a correct installation I shall be able to boot the full MintOS by holding the 'Option' key and shall be able to save all changes when I log out of each session.
